    A—0 to 15 centimeters (0.0 to 5.9 inches); very dark grayish brown (10YR 3/2), grayish brown (10YR 5/2), dry; silt loam; weak fine subangular blocky structure; friable; 3 percent by volume nonflat indurated 2-39-75 millimeter mixed fragments observed by visual inspection method; moderately acid, pH 6.0, hellige-truog; abrupt smooth boundary.; dry when described;
    E—15 to 30 centimeters (5.9 to 11.8 inches); brown (10YR 5/3), very pale brown (10YR 7/3), dry; silt loam; weak thin platy structure; friable; 3 percent by volume nonflat indurated 2-39-75 millimeter mixed fragments observed by visual inspection method; slightly acid, pH 6.1, hellige-truog; clear wavy boundary.; dry when described;
    B/E—30 to 48 centimeters (11.8 to 18.9 inches); 75 percent brown (7.5YR 4/4) and 25 percent brown (10YR 5/3), very pale brown (10YR 7/3), dry; silt loam; weak medium platy structure; friable; medium distinct yellowish brown (10YR 5/6), moist, masses of oxidized iron; 1 percent by volume nonflat indurated 75-162-250 millimeter mixed fragments observed by visual inspection method and 3 percent by volume nonflat indurated 2-39-75 millimeter mixed fragments observed by visual inspection method; strongly acid, pH 5.5, hellige-truog; gradual wavy boundary.; dry when described;. Horizon was desscribed as having few redoximorphic concentrations; no percentage given.
    2Bt1—48 to 74 centimeters (18.9 to 29.1 inches); brown (7.5YR 4/4) fine sandy loam; 1 percent strong brown (7.5YR 5/6) medium distinct mottles; weak medium subangular blocky structure; friable; distinct dark brown (7.5YR 3/4) clay films on faces of peds; medium distinct strong brown (7.5YR 5/6), moist, masses of oxidized iron; 2 percent by volume nonflat indurated 75-162-250 millimeter mixed fragments observed by visual inspection method and 12 percent by volume nonflat indurated 2-39-75 millimeter mixed fragments observed by visual inspection method; slightly acid, pH 6.1, hellige-truog; clear wavy boundary.; dry when described;. Horizon was desscribed as having few redoximorphic concentrations; no percentage given.; discontinuous - phpvsfiid 104278; discontinuous - phpvsfiid 104278
    2Bt2—74 to 99 centimeters (29.1 to 39.0 inches); brown (7.5YR 4/4) fine sandy loam; moderate medium platy structure; firm; distinct dark brown (7.5YR 3/4) clay films on bottoms of plates; medium distinct strong brown (7.5YR 4/6), moist, masses of oxidized iron on surfaces along root channels and medium faint brown (7.5YR 5/3), moist, iron depletions on surfaces along root channels; 2 percent by volume nonflat indurated 75-162-250 millimeter mixed fragments observed by visual inspection method and 8 percent by volume nonflat indurated 2-39-75 millimeter mixed fragments observed by visual inspection method; slightly acid, pH 6.1, hellige-truog; gradual wavy boundary.; moist when described;. Redoximorphic features in 2Bt2 seem to follow root channels only.; Horizon was desscribed as having few redoximorphic concentrations and depletions; no percentage given.; discontinuous - phpvsfiid 104279; discontinuous - phpvsfiid 104279
    2BCd—99 to 132 centimeters (39.0 to 52.0 inches); brown (7.5YR 4/4) sandy loam; moderate medium platy, and moderate coarse platy structure; very firm; 2 percent by volume nonflat indurated 75-162-250 millimeter mixed fragments observed by visual inspection method and 8 percent by volume nonflat indurated 2-39-75 millimeter mixed fragments observed by visual inspection method; neutral, pH 6.6, hellige-truog; gradual wavy boundary.; moist when described;
    2Cd—132 to 203 centimeters (52.0 to 79.9 inches); reddish brown (5YR 4/3) fine sandy loam; moderate coarse platy, and moderate medium platy structure; very firm; 2 percent by volume nonflat indurated 75-162-250 millimeter mixed fragments observed by visual inspection method and 10 percent by volume nonflat indurated 2-39-75 millimeter mixed fragments observed by visual inspection method; neutral, pH 6.7, hellige-truog.; moist when described;
